After back-to-back finals in Pomona, Langdon looking to close the deal
POMONA, Calif. (Nov. 8) – A solid performance at this weekend's Auto Club NHRA Finals is crucial for Shawn Langdon and the Lucas Oil/Speedco Top Fuel dragster team on several levels.
The Lucas Oil team is already locked into a ninth-place season finish, but Langdon said a deep run at the birthplace of drag racing will do a lot to make the off season a little shorter.
"There's not a lot of championship pressure on us, but there is a lot riding on this last race," Langdon said. "I'd like to see us spoil the day of someone fighting for the championship.
"I want to end the year on a good note for us. It would get the guys spirits' up for the offseason and end the year for us with some momentum. It keeps everyone positive through the off season."
Langdon is hoping to extend his string of recent success as Auto Club Raceway.
"The last two races we've been there we've made the finals," Langdon said. "I would be really, really nice to make that final step and get our first win this time. I want to finish out what we couldn't get done the last couple of years."
Langdon lost to Tony Schumacher in last year's Auto Club Finals championship round and to teammate Morgan Lucas in the finals of the Winternationals in February.
"It's a home track for me," Langdon said. "My family and a lot of friends are going to be out there as are a lot of people from Lucas Oil. So a good race is always important."
Langdon said he's not looking forward to a long, cold winter without racing.
"It's getting toward the end of the year and I'm trying to get in as much racing as I can before the winter," Langdon said. "I'm getting my fix in."
